Quarry
The is a large copper mine located in , in the southwestern part of the . Bagdad represents one of the largest copper reserves in the and in the world, having estimated reserves of 873.6 million tonnes of ore grading 0.36% copper.

Locality
is a copper mining community and census-designated place in , , United States, in the western part of the state. It is one of only two remaining company towns in Arizona.
